  • #78 - Concussion Guidelines for Return-to-Play with Dr. Mike Olson, Part 2

    19 APR 2024 · Concussion Guidelines for Return-to-Play with Dr. Mike Olson, Part 2 Concussion management and post-concussion care is multifaceted and highly individualized.  One person may have a fairly easy recovery and little long-term effects from a head injury whereas another person with an almost identical brain trauma can be permanently disabled. The scientific community has made incredible advances in the last decade in our understanding of the short and long term effects of concussion, but there are still a number of mysteries when it comes to the physiological, neurological, mental and emotional inner workings of the human brain.But one thing is for certain -- athletic organizations at ALL levels have finally become acutely aware of the importance of protecting the brain. In part 1 of this fascinating 2 part training, you'll learn from Dr. Mike Olson, a nationally and internationally certified chiropractic sports physician that heads up the concussion management program at BigFork Valley Hospital in Minnesota. He will walk us through the internationally recognized return-to-sport guidelines and provide us with a step-by-step approach to managing concussion throughout every phase of the healing process.Guest Instructor:  Dr. Olson is the current Allied Health Services Manager at Bigfork Valley Hospital, overseeing the daily operations of the Chiropractic Department, Rehabilitation Department and the onsite fitness center. He is a 2011 graduate of Palmer College of Chiropractic and was hired by Bigfork Valley Hospital to develop and integrate it’s first chiropractic department. He has been employed there since 2011. He has special interests in sports injury and concussion management, peripheral nerve entrapment and various soft tissue treatment modalities and chiropractic rehabilitation. He is currently an adjunct faculty for Palmer College of Chiropractic, the team physician for Bigfork High School, and an instructor for FAKTR, having developed the Peripheral Nerve Entrapment courses and the concussion management course.  Throughout the chiropractic literature, Dr. Olson has numerous publications in peripheral nerve entrapment, concussion management, and sports-injuries.   • #76 - Dr. Janette Kurban on Ancient Ear Acupuncture Points and Modern Practice, Part 2

    22 MAR 2024 · Auriculotherapy and Clinical Practice Pt 2 with Dr. Janette Kurban In today's episode we pick back up with our fascinating course on auriculotherapy with Dr. Janette Kurban.  In Part 1 of this training, Dr. Kurban introduced the 12 master points of auriculotherapy (acupuncture that is applied to specific points on the ear).  It was incredible to hear about the various ways that these tiny points in the ear can create substantial changes in the body, impacting everything from hormones to anxiety, hypertension and of course musculoskeletal pain. Today, we talk through a number of case studies and real-world examples of how to apply auriculotherapy in your practice including combining acupuncture as part of a multi-modal treatment plan.We touch on the effects of bilateral vs. unilateral treatment and the clinical decision making involved with determining where to start and how to introduce and explain this type of therapy to a patient. Guest Instructor: Janette, Kurban, DC, DACBA Dr. Janette Kurban is a renowned figure in the realm of integrative medicine, combining the ancient wisdom of acupuncture with modern chiropractic techniques. Along with her doctorate in chiropractic, she has earned her Diplomate in Chiropractic Acupuncture from the ACA’s Board of Chiropractic Acupuncture; a distinction recognized both nationally and internationally, that endorses her expertise in acupuncture as it relates to chiropractic care.   • #74 - Therapeutic Laser for Treating Pain, Part 2

    23 FEB 2024 · Innovations in Laser Therapy in the Treatment of Pain (Part 2 of 2) Guest: Mark Callanen, PT, DPT, OCS When you're faced with a decision to add a new therapeutic device or piece of equipment to your practice, it's easy to get overwhelmed with the variety of options currently on the market. Whatever choice you make must have a positive impact on patient outcomes and provide a great ROI or return on your investment.But much like a hammer or screwdriver in your garage toolbox, any device you implement into practice is only useful if you know how to leverage it to achieve your goals. In Part 1 of this 2 part training, our guest presenter Dr. Mark Collanen gave an overview of the evidence supporting laser therapy's, impacts on nerve function tissue repair, collagen formation and the perception of pain. In today's episode, we will cover laser therapy dosing protocols and how to target varying tissue depths for specific conditions. And if you're a healthcare provider with doubts about wearable laser technology, stay tuned. We'll give you the lowdown on red flags to watch out for and how to assess the veracity of the technology you might be considering. Whether you currently use laser therapy in practice or are just intrigued enough to want to learn more, this episode will certainly give you a better understanding of this powerful therapeutic intervention.   • #69 - Shockwave Therapy for Post-Surgical Care, Part 2

    15 DEC 2023 · Shockwave Therapy for Post-Surgical Care Part 2 featuring Dr. David Rudnick In today's episode, we chat about the successful implementation of Shockwave therapy for various orthopedic cases and talk about its potential to reduce the economic burden on the health system and improve patient outcomes.One intriguing aspect highlighted in this episode was how Dr. Rudnick integrates movement and rehabilitation protocols (like FAKTR) with shockwave therapy.
